Bowling is a sport that almost anyone can participate in for a lifetime. And during the summer, children can do it for free.

The 'Kids Bowl Free' summer bowling program provides children with two free games of bowling all summer long, while helping bowling centers generate traffic.

There are more than 1,500 bowling centers that participate in the program. Last summer, more than 2 million children signed up.

You can see if there ’s a participating bowling center near you and then register your child by visiting kidsbowlfree.com. Then, the organization will send you coupons that can be redeemed throughout the summer. Each child that registers receives over $200 of free bowling games.
